Balancing autonomy and guidance among team members: Are you equipped to meet their diverse needs?
Striking the right balance between team autonomy and managerial guidance ensures all members feel supported yet free to innovate. To achieve this harmony:
- Establish clear objectives. This allows team members to understand expectations while exploring their own methods of achieving goals.
- Provide resources and support. Ensure access to tools and mentorship without micromanaging, fostering a sense of independence.
- Regularly check-in. Offer feedback and adapt guidance based on individual progress and needs.

As a leader, it's essential to balance autonomy and guidance by understanding each team member's unique strengths and preferences. I encourage open communication, set clear goals, and provide the necessary resources while allowing flexibility in how tasks are approached. Regular check-ins help me gauge their comfort levels and offer support when needed. By fostering collaboration and adapting my leadership style, I empower my team to thrive independently while ensuring they know I'm here to guide them when required.

I typically use the Situational Leadership framework to balance autonomy and guidance by assessing where each team member falls within the four quadrants: Directing, Coaching, Supporting, and Delegating. For this a clear objective needs to be given. Some colleagues need more guidance due to their experience or commitment levels, while others require less. I collaborate with my team to analyze where they stand, ensuring each person gets the leadership style they need. Applying too much or too little guidance can demotivate them, so it's crucial to adjust my approach—offering structure to those needing direction and more autonomy to those ready to take the lead.

Balancing autonomy with guidance involves understanding each team member's strengths, preferences, and development needs. Start by setting clear expectations and goals, providing a framework within which team members can operate independently. Encourage open communication, allowing team members to seek guidance when needed while trusting them to make decisions within their areas of expertise. Regularly check in to offer support and feedback, adjusting the level of guidance based on individual progress and confidence. Foster a culture of continuous learning, where team members feel empowered to take initiative and innovate, knowing they have the support they need to succeed.
